(Photo: Gabrielle Mercer/WCSN) Despite a fast start, Arizona State left Matthews Arena winless on the weekend. No. 17 Northeastern defeated the Sun Devils 6-1 on Saturday night, holding the Arizona State offense without a goal for the subsequent 52 minutes following the first period goal. Who We Are

The Walter Cronkite Sports Network is the premier student-run source for Arizona State sports. All content produced comes from students at ASU’s Walter Cronkite School of Journalism and Mass Communication.
